Beyond the numbers

What each city asks you to trade

Costs and scores help narrow the choice. These practical strengths and limitations finish the picture.

Albuquerque United States

Strengths

  • Affordable cost of living
  • Year-round sunshine and mild winters
  • Vibrant local food and art scene
  • Great base for outdoor adventures (Sandia Mountains, Rio Grande)
  • Relatively quiet and uncrowded compared to larger US cities
  • Growing remote work community

Trade-offs

  • Higher crime rates in certain neighborhoods
  • Limited public transit and car-dependent layout
  • Extreme heat in summer (Jul-Sep)
  • Air quality can be poor due to dust and pollen
  • Not a major international hub – fewer direct flights
  • Some areas lack walkability and pedestrian infrastructure

Common visa routes

  • B1/B2 Tourist Visa
  • ESTA (Visa Waiver)
  • H-1B Work Visa
Asunción Paraguay

Strengths

  • Very low cost of living
  • Friendly and welcoming locals
  • Stable economy with low inflation
  • Easy residency process for nomads
  • Pleasant climate from April to October
  • Good street food scene

Trade-offs

  • Extreme heat and humidity from November to March
  • Limited English spoken outside expat hubs
  • Public transportation is chaotic and old
  • Tap water not drinkable
  • Occasional power outages
  • Slow bureaucracy for long-term visas

Common visa routes

  • Tourist visa (90 days, extendable)
  • Pensionado visa (monthly income ~$1,300)
  • Rentista visa (investment or passive income)
